Finally getting stuck back into the 2GR conversion..
 
Standard flywheel removal

 
New 1MZ flywheel installed, unfortunately missing locating dowels, so no fitting gearbox ATM

 
New serpertine belt fitted

 
Time to cut off the factory cats & attempt making my own exhaust utilising existing manny, then connect up to my Y pipe

 
Gonna need a slight S bend piping, but think it will work

 
Its only about 200mm in length required, again a slight S bend required. Its going to be a 2" pipe up from the Y piping expanding to a 2.25" to meet up with the manifold piping

 
Mockup fitment of how it should sit once pieces are welded in

Looking great Mike. I would suggest removing the oil cooler, dismantling it then having it ultrasonic cleaned as it get very dirty in the elements of the cooler. Also recommend removing the camshaft oil galleries in the cam covers have the same treatment as these are two places which are easily missed but can cause a lot of grief.

Fit test on manifold, few extra sleeves to get it down to 2" piping to the Y pipe

 
Ready for a proper weld, my homemade 2GR manifold....cause Im a tight arse & didnt want to spend the $700++USD on the Gouky headers

 
Welded, fitted up perfectly... now for the otherside

 

 
Otherside tac welded in place ready to be welded

 
Welded & bolted in place

 
Happy with where it sits & plenty of clearance

 
Engine harness installed, engine ready for installation
